Installing the ECM-2
This procedure assumes that:
l The shelf is properly grounded to the rack; and
l The shelf and module have been properly inspected.
1. Verify that you are properly grounded with an anti-static wrist strap or heel strap
connected to the grounded ESDjack.
2. Hold the ECM-2 with the faceplate toward you and the levers extended.
3. Align the ECM-2 edges with the guides of the shelf slot.
4. Lift out on the levers and gently apply pressure to the bottom of the faceplate while
pushing the module into the slot.
5. Push on the faceplate to fully seat the module.
6. Press down on the locking levers to secure the module and connect it to the
backplane. The module is completely inserted when its faceplate is flush with the
faceplates of the adjacent modules and the shelf panels.
7. When the ECM-2 is inserted completely, hand tighten the thumb screws to prevent
inadvertent dislodging.
8. Use a Torx T10 screwdriver to gently tighten the thumb screws. Do not overtighten.
